当前位置:首页 > 问答 > 正文

性能优化|高效运维|Redis软件配置实现极致服务性能的关键路径,redis软件配置

性能优化|高效运维|Redis软件配置实现极致服务性能的关键路径:

  1. 内存管理

    • 最大内存配置(maxmemory)
    • 淘汰策略(LRU/LFU/allkeys-lru/volatile-lru)
    • 内存碎片整理(activedefrag)
  2. 持久化配置

    性能优化|高效运维|Redis软件配置实现极致服务性能的关键路径,redis软件配置

    • RDB快照(save指令/触发条件)
    • AOF重写(auto-aof-rewrite-percentage/min-size)
    • 混合持久化(aof-use-rdb-preamble)
  3. 网络与连接

    • TCP backlog(tcp-backlog)
    • 客户端超时(timeout/tcp-keepalive)
    • 最大连接数(maxclients)
  4. 线程模型

    • IO多线程(io-threads/io-threads-do-reads)
    • 后台任务线程(bio相关参数)
  5. 数据结构优化

    性能优化|高效运维|Redis软件配置实现极致服务性能的关键路径,redis软件配置

    • Hash/List的编码优化(ziplist/hash-max-ziplist-entries)
    • 整数集合(intset)配置
  6. 集群与高可用

    • 主从复制(repl-backlog-size/repl-diskless-sync)
    • 哨兵配置(sentinel monitor/quorum)
    • Cluster节点超时(cluster-node-timeout)
  7. 内核参数调优

    • 透明大页(THP)禁用
    • 系统内存分配策略(vm.overcommit_memory)
  8. 监控与诊断

    性能优化|高效运维|Redis软件配置实现极致服务性能的关键路径,redis软件配置

    • 慢查询日志(slowlog-log-slower-than)
    • 内存监控(info memory/used_memory_rss)

注:配置需结合业务场景测试验证,参考版本为Redis 7.x+。

发表评论